Romans 3:23-28

23For all men sinned, and have need to the glory of God; (For all have sinned, and have need of God’s glory;)
24and be justified freely by his grace, by the again-buying or by the redemption that is in Christ (or that is in the Messiah).
25Whom God ordained (the) forgiver or purposed (as) an helper, by faith in his blood, to the showing of his rightwiseness, for the remission of before-going sins, in the bearing up of God,
26to the showing of his rightwiseness in this time, that he be just, and justifying him that is of the faith of Jesus Christ.
27Where then is thy glorying? (or Then where is thy boasting?) It is excluded. By what law? Of deeds doing? Nay, but by the law of faith.
28For we deem a man to be justified by faith, without works of the law.
